Lisa Citore has used poetry as an expression for her healing journey and a way to inspire and empower other women to share their truth since her early twenties. In addition to being a slam poet, representing Cleveland, Ohio, finishing third in the ’98 Slam Poetry Nationals, Lisa wrote greeting cards for a fortune 500 card corporation for 15 years, creating several humorous and conventional alternative card lines which still sell all over the world today.
Lisa is currently producing a CD of her poetry entitled,
Keep It Wet. The best of over a decade of adventures, her CD promises to be provocative, fierce and authentically vulnerable, expressing the wild heart of a woman on her path.
Along with her personal projects, Lisa will be co-leading a young women’s poetry circle - ages 12-18 - with the hope of creating a performance based on the collective writing of the circle [Fall 2008].
